# FV function
|
# FV
|
||||||
## Overview
|
|
||||||
FV (<u>F</u>uture <u>V</u>alue) is a function of the Financial category that can be used to predict the future value of an investment or asset based on its present value.
|
|
||||||
|
|
||||||
FV can be used to calculate future value over a specified number of compounding periods. A fixed interest rate or yield is assumed over all periods, and a fixed payment or deposit can be applied at the start or end of every period.
|
::: warning
|
||||||
|
🚧 This function is implemented but currently lacks detailed documentation. For guidance, you may refer to the equivalent functionality in [Microsoft Excel documentation](https://support.microsoft.com/en-us/office/excel-functions-by-category-5f91f4e9-7b42-46d2-9bd1-63f26a86c0eb).
|
||||||
If your interest rate varies between periods, use the [FVSCHEDULE](/functions/financial/fvschedule) function instead of FV.
|
:::
|
||||||
## Usage
|
|
||||||
### Syntax
|
|
||||||
**FV(rate, nper, pmt, pv, type)**
|
|
||||||
### Argument descriptions
|
|
||||||
* *rate*. The fixed percentage interest rate or yield per period.
|
|
||||||
* *nper*. The number of compounding periods to be taken into account. While this will often be an integer, non-integer values are accepted and processed.
|
|
||||||
* *pmt*. The fixed amount paid or deposited each compounding period.
|
|
||||||
* *pv* (optional). The present value or starting amount of the asset (default 0).
|
|
||||||
* *type* (optional). A logical value indicating whether the payment due dates are at the end (0) of the compounding periods or at the beginning (any non-zero value). The default is 0 when omitted.
|
|
||||||
### Additional guidance
|
|
||||||
* Make sure that the *rate* argument specifies the interest rate or yield applicable to the compounding period, based on the value chosen for *nper*.
|
|
||||||
* The *pmt* and *pv* arguments should be expressed in the same currency unit. The value returned is expressed in the same currency unit.
|
|
||||||
* To ensure a worthwhile result, one of the *pmt* and *pv* arguments should be non-zero.
|
|
||||||
* The setting of the *type* argument only affects the calculation for non-zero values of the *pmt* argument.
|
|
||||||
<!--@include: ../markdown-snippets/error-type-details.md-->
|
|
||||||
|
|
||||||
## Details
|
|
||||||
* If *rate* = 0, FV is given by the equation:
|
|
||||||
$$
|
|
||||||
FV = -pv - (pmt \times nper)
|
|
||||||
$$
|
|
||||||
|
|
||||||
* If *rate* <> 0 and *type* = 0, FV is given by the equation:
|
|
||||||
$$ FV = -pv \times (1 + rate)^{nper} - \dfrac{pmt\times\big({(1+rate)^{nper}-1}\big)}{rate}
|
|
||||||
$$
|
|
||||||
* If *rate* <> 0 and *type* <> 0, FV is given by the equation:
|
|
||||||
$$ FV = -pv \times (1 + rate)^{nper} - \dfrac{pmt\times\big({(1+rate)^{nper}-1}\big) \times(1+rate)}{rate}
|
|
||||||
$$
|
|
